C–H functionalization through benzylic deprotonation with π-coordination or cation–π-interactions
Hui Zhu, Yu Wu, Jianyou Mao, Jingkai Xu, Patrick J. Walsh, Hang Shi
Abstract
Transition-metals bind arene π-systems, removing e − density and acidifying benzylic C–H’s. Main group metals achieve this via cation–π interactions. Both interactions enable catalytic base-promoted selective C–H functionalization.
